fire alarm control panel batteries are typically rechargeable sealed lead-acid batteries that are designed to provide backup power to fire alarm systems. These batteries are connected to the control panel and are constantly charged when the system is running on mains power. In the event of a power outage, the batteries automatically take over, providing power to the control panel and allowing it to continue operating.
The primary function of fire alarm control panel batteries is to ensure that the system remains operational during a power failure. Without backup batteries, the control panel would be unable to detect smoke or fire, sound alarms, or communicate with other devices in the system. This can result in a delayed response to a fire emergency, putting occupants at risk and potentially leading to property damage.
To ensure the reliability of fire alarm control panel batteries, it is essential to perform regular maintenance checks. One of the primary maintenance tasks is to test the batteries regularly to ensure they are holding a charge. This can be done using a multimeter to measure the voltage of the batteries. It is recommended to perform this test at least once a year to ensure the batteries are in good working condition.
Another important aspect of battery maintenance is to check for any signs of corrosion on the battery terminals or cables. Corrosion can hinder the flow of electricity and reduce the effectiveness of the batteries during an emergency. If corrosion is present, it should be cleaned using a mixture of baking soda and water to prevent further deterioration.
In addition to regular maintenance checks, it is also important to replace fire alarm control panel batteries according to the manufacturer’s recommendations. Most batteries have a lifespan of 3-5 years, after which they may start to lose their capacity and effectiveness. By replacing the batteries on schedule, building owners can ensure that their fire alarm system remains reliable and operational.
When replacing fire alarm control panel batteries, it is important to use batteries that meet the specifications provided by the manufacturer. Using the wrong type of battery can lead to compatibility issues and potentially damage the control panel. It is recommended to consult with a professional fire alarm technician to determine the correct replacement batteries for your specific system.
